here). Well, today, I wanted to share one that I made for my youngest niece, Leighton. Leighton is a tomboy gone girly-girl, and I knew these turtles would be right up her alley!
Seriously, how cute are these turtles?? (Though I must admit they gave me a bit of grief… I am used to stamping and then coloring an image, but this particular set does not lend itself to that technique. I initially tried stamping and embossing the image and then coloring with my Copics -- ruining a couple, I fear, in the process… Then I tried stamping with Versamark ink and applying chalks (nice result, though super-tedious!)… But none of these really gave me the look I was going for. I had never tried direct-to-rubber coloring (mainly because all I had was Copics and I didn't think that was possible with them…), but decided that was just gonna have to be the technique for these images… So, I bit the bullet and bought a handful of markers designed for direct-to-rubber, and….. voila! Colorful Turtles! :)

I did come back in and color my gems and pearls with my Copics for some added bling… Gotta have that! :) And the sentiment is all mine -- not a lot of pre-made sentiments fit for turtles stacked on top of each other! :)
